Walter Klimczak

Walter Klimczak, aged 23, of 501 South Bendix drive. died at 12:18 a. m. today, Oct 27, 1948, in Memorial hospital after an illness of two months. Born in South Bend Feb. 8. 1925. he had lived here all his life.

On Feb. 8, 1947, he was married in St. Adalbert's Catholic church by Rev. Ignatius J. Gapczynski, pastor, to Miss Mary Koszyk, who survivies. Also surviving are his mother, Mrs. Josephine Nowak, 521 South Walnut street: two brothers, Stanley, jr., of Cincinnati, O., and Edmund, of South Bend, d, and two step-brothers, Edward jr., of South Bend, and Brother Bernard, O.F.M., of Cedar Ind.

Friends may call in the home after 5 p.m. Thursday. The funeral will be held at 11 a. m. Saturday in St. Adalbert's church with Father Gapczynski officiating. Burial will be in St. Joseph Polish cemetery.
